Coffee run with a 1979 Alfa Romeo Alfetta

Going to get a coffee and danish at Bloom and Brews in the 1979 Alfa Romeo Alfetta on a summer Sunday morning. The Alfetta makes for a perfect quick trip car in almost any weather. The SPICA was traded out for a more vivacious set of aftermarket Weber style carburetors. The rebuilt transmission makes for an effortless trip down the backroads. New autocross tires make for a smooth and responsive ride. The last chassis type from Alfa Romeo until the 4C to not have power steering allows you to get uninterrupted feedback from the road. Its truly a connected feel to the art of driving. You need both hands for driving, so no cup holders. Alfa Romeos are for driving, not the drive thru.
